What was the most profitable Halo game?

Halo 3. It was the fastest-selling video game ever and held the record for biggest entertainment launch in history with $170 million in sales within the first 24 hours and $300 million in one week.

Why did Halo Infinite take out assassinations?

Assassinations - animations that are triggered when you creep up on an enemy player and melee them from behind - have long been a Halo staple. But despite the team at 343i "really lov[ing] assassinations", they've been removed because of the "gameplay disadvantage" to pulling one off.

Is Halo Infinite not popular?

Halo Infinite isn't in the Top 10 of most-played Steam games. In fact, at a little more than six months old - and its fan-favourite multiplayer component entirely free-to-play and available on Steam - Halo Infinite doesn't even breach the top 50 games that boast the highest concurrent player numbers.
